Comprehending Mobility Scooters

Mobility scooters are electrically powered gadgets developed for people with limited mobility. They supply a means of transportation for individuals who might have difficulty walking however still wish to retain their self-reliance. They can be found in different designs and functions to accommodate a large range of requirements.

Types of Mobility Scooters

Mobility scooters can generally be categorized into three primary types:

Type

Description

Best For

Compact Scooters

These are small and lightweight, ideal for inside and short trips.

Users with minimal storage area or those who travel often.

Mid-size Scooters

A balance between portability and stability, suitable for both indoor and outdoor usage.

Those who need to cover a variety of terrains.

Heavy-duty Scooters

Big and robust, created for rugged outdoor usage and heavier individuals.

Users needing additional weight capability or going off-road.

Secret Features of Mobility Scooters

The option of mobility scooter typically depends upon the functions that line up with private requirements. Here are some of the essential features to consider:

  • Range: The distance a scooter can travel on a single charge varies. Depending on user needs, one may choose for scooters with a series of up to 40 miles.
  • Speed: Most mobility scooters can reach speeds between 4 to 8 miles per hour. Consider what speed is comfy and safe for the designated environment.
  •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is vital for indoor use, enabling for simpler navigation in tight areas.
  • Battery Type: The kind of batteries utilized can affect the scooter's efficiency.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most typical.

Benefits of Using Mobility Scooters

The benefits of mobility scooters extend beyond simply transport. Some crucial advantages consist of:

  • Independence: Users can navigate their environment without relying on caregivers, promoting independence and confidence.
  • Health Benefits: Using a scooter can encourage outdoor activity, causing physical and mental health enhancements by decreasing sensations of seclusion.
  • Convenience: Scooters can easily be operated in various environments, whether inside, in shopping malls, or outdoors.

Important Considerations When Buying a Mobility Scooter

When buying a mobility scooter, a number of considerations can assist guarantee that you choose the ideal design:

  1. Assess Individual Needs:

    • Mobility level: Consider just how much support the person will require.
    • Series of usage: Determine where the scooter will mostly be utilized (inside, outdoors, on rough surfaces, etc).
  2. Test Drive:

    • Always test drive numerous models to find an appropriate fit. Take notice of comfort, ease of steering, and the scooter's responsiveness.
  3. Review Safety Features:

    • Look for scooters with adequate safety functions like lights, indicators, and anti-tip designs.
  4. Examine Warranty and Service Options:

    • A reputable guarantee and offered service options are important for long-term use.

FAQs about Mobility Scooters

**1. How quick do mobility scooters go?Mobility scooters normally have speeds ranging from 4 to 8 miles per hour, with most created for safety rather than high-speed travel. 2. Are there weight constraints on mobility scooters?Yes, mobility

scooters include particular weight limitations, frequently ranging from
250 lbs to over 500 pounds, depending on the design. 3. Can mobility scooters be used indoors?Certain designs, especially compact scooters, are particularly designed for

**indoor usage and are easier to navigate in tight spaces. 4. How frequently do the batteries require to be replaced?Battery life can vary based upon use, however typically, with proper care, batteries might last in between 1 to 3 years before needing replacement

**. 5. Are mobility scooters covered by insurance?Coverage can differ, however some insurance plans, consisting of Medicare and Medicaid, may cover part of the cost. It's advised to examine with private insurance service providers. Mobility scooters serve as a
